Staying Cool and Quiet: A Car Insulation Buying Guide
This guide helps you pick the best heat and sound insulation for your car. It makes your car rides much better!
Key Features to Look For
When you shop for car insulation, you want to find the right features.
- Thickness: Thicker insulation usually blocks more heat and noise. But you need to make sure it fits! Measure the space you have.
- Coverage Area: How much space will the insulation cover? Make sure you buy enough to cover the areas you need.
- Adhesive: Does the insulation have a sticky back? This makes it easy to install.
- Temperature Rating: Insulation has a temperature rating. It tells you how hot it can get before it breaks down.
- Durability: Pick insulation that lasts. It should resist tearing and wear.
Important Materials
Different materials do different jobs. Knowing these materials helps you choose.
- Butyl Rubber: This is a popular material for sound deadening. It’s good at stopping vibrations.
- Foam: Foam insulation often traps air. This helps to block heat and noise. There are different types of foam, like closed-cell foam, which is water-resistant.
- Fiberglass: Fiberglass is good at blocking heat. It’s often used for insulation.
- Aluminum: Some insulation has an aluminum layer. Aluminum reflects heat.
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Some things make insulation better or worse.
- Density: Denser materials often work better at blocking sound.
- Quality of Materials: Using better materials means better insulation.
- Installation: How well you install the insulation matters. Make sure it fits snugly.
- Seams and Gaps: Any gaps will let in heat and noise. Cover everything!
- Brand Reputation: Some brands are known for making high-quality products.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Here are some common questions about car insulation.
Q: Why should I insulate my car?
A: Car insulation makes your ride quieter and more comfortable. It also helps keep your car cooler in the summer and warmer in the winter.
Q: What’s the difference between heat and sound insulation?
A: Heat insulation blocks heat. Sound insulation blocks noise. Some products do both!
Q: How do I measure for car insulation?
A: Measure the areas you want to cover. Get the length and width. Then, add a little extra for overlap.
Q: Is car insulation hard to install?
A: It depends on the product. Some have a sticky back and are easy to install. Other products require more work.
Q: What tools do I need to install car insulation?
A: You might need a utility knife, scissors, a measuring tape, and maybe some gloves.
Q: Can I install car insulation on my own?
A: Yes! Many people install insulation themselves. Just follow the instructions.
